When roofing, think about safety first. Attempting leak repairs during rainstorms can cause serious injuries. Put a bucket beneath the leak until it stops raining, and work on the problem after the roof has dried out.

Never, under any circumstances paint your roof as a way to give it a new look. Doing so may void any warranty you have which could end up costing you quite a bit of money if something unfortunate were to happen. If your roof is showing signs of age, a good cleaning may be all you need.

When choosing between roofing contractors, contact your local Better Business Bureau for advice. They will let you know if any of the firms you are considering have complaints filed against them, a major red flag. You can also learn how long they have been serving your community as a company.

Rubber soled shoes are a must when you get up on your roof. Even in dry conditions you will reduce the chance of slipping if you wear the right kind of boots. Doing repair work up on the roof can be tricky and dangerous because of the awkward footing, so take safety precautions.

After you've narrowed down your list of contractors, talk to them about what kind of warranties they have available. Don't contract with anyone who offers a warranty of less than three years. Five or more years is ideal. The warranty needs to cover defective supplies and sup-par workmanship, and they should also supply you with copies of the manufacturer warranties too.

Carefully check the written estimate that you are given by a professional roofer. Make sure to document when your project starts, the estimation of when it's to be completed, and what payments are made. Avoid paying in full up front. Make sure the warranty is clear and that you understand what voids it.

If you are trying to figure out the cause of a leak, but the problem is not obvious, you should look at the shingles in the area very closely. If they are nailed down incorrectly, are not secure or are even just slightly cracked, they could be the cause of the leak.

One of the main reasons for roof leaks are due to clogged gutters. When you don't clean your gutters regularly, you allow water to buildup whenever it rains. This in turn, can cause leaks to occur. Be sure and clean your gutters of all debris regularly so as to prevent this from happening.

Don't be too tempted by sales or special offers. While it is great to get a deal on your roof, that is not the only reason that you should select a certain company or roofer. Although operating within a budget is important, you still need to make sure that a knowledgeable professional performs the work.

If you notice that your roof is leaking, call a roofer immediately. The longer you wait, the more money it is going to cost you because the damage will add up. If you are concerned about the cost involved, ask the roofer if they offer payment plans, as a lot of companies do have that option now.

Do not be alarmed if a roofer asks you for a deposit. Receiving some money ahead of the job lets the company gather the appropriate materials for working on your roof. However, it is important to know what constitutes a standard deposit. Generally, about 25 percent is considered normal. Half of the total cost of the roof is way too much.

Check out a contractor's work history before you consider hiring them. Verify these references by personally calling past clients so you can determine the quality of their work. In addition, if your contractor has current clients, drive by the clients' homes so that you can check out the contractor's work firsthand.

OSHA requirements state that any roofing contractor should develop safety plans for the project they're working on. This will ensure that each project gets done in the proper manner. Before hiring a contractor, make sure they have their safety plan put in place. If they don't, it is likely in your best interest to find a new contractor.

If you need to do work on your roof, don't do it alone. Climbing on a roof can be dangerous, and you'll be much safer if you have another person there to assist you. If the worst happens and you have an accident, you want to make sure someone can get you help immediately.
